Output d3c1168a35dd06a116bfeaa33b7b81cdc6f06a9ecfdf11a6f91ea2f12a22e106:2

value
125682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842cc5afa7cd8a5662ba709689aefcd7573986a6 OP_EQUAL
address
3DjtkhA4AiuAHUUdAZmcM7AdwqhZx5ziiV
transaction
d3c1168a35dd06a116bfeaa33b7b81cdc6f06a9ecfdf11a6f91ea2f12a22e106
spent
true